Charles B. Goodwin, M.D. is a distinguished spine surgeon based in New York, NY, renowned for his expertise in diagnosing and treating cervical and lumbar spine conditions. Dr. Goodwin collaborates closely with rehabilitation specialists and pain management physicians, emphasizing non-operative approaches such as physical therapy and spine injections.
With a career spanning over several decades, Dr. Goodwin is known for his pioneering work in arthroscopic and minimally invasive spine surgeries. He has a notable track record, having performed significant procedures like the first endoscopic spine fusion, as highlighted in The Wall Street Journal. Notably, he has developed innovative instrumentation and implants for minimally invasive spinal fusions.
Aside from his clinical practice, Dr. Goodwin has an extensive background in sports medicine, having served as a team physician for various sports teams and tournaments. His commitment to advancing orthopedic care is reflected in his involvement with professional organizations and ongoing research activities, ensuring the highest quality of patient care.
